He is a likely a sociopath.

Beth Reid, one of the prosecutors on the case, said after the verdict that she never witnessed Frazee express anything other than the emotionless state he exhibited in court.

"I think based on my observations of Patrick Frazee over the last year, that there’s a potential that Patrick Frazee indicates and is consistent with a sociopath," Reid said. "And that’s a person who has basically an inability to feel empathy with other people."

Someone else may have already said. But I just found on the cell data at 4:39 PF sends KK a text to wish her a Happy Thanksgiving, then asked her to call when she can.

4 minutes later @4:43 she does. They talk for 2 minutes and 21 seconds.

@ 4:50 he calls her again, they talk for 4 minutes. He has KB cell with him.
